Average score for Goal 1-6 indicators. The primary data source is the UN SDG database. Whilst this is a database with comprehensive coverage that all countries have signed up to, it is clear that many (particularly developed countries) are not yet submitting their available national data. Scores for these countries are likely to represent an indicator of their willingness to submit national data rather than their performance in calculating the indicators. For OECD countries, we supplement the UN SDG database with comparable data submitted to the OECD following the methodology in Measuring Distance to the SDG Targets 2019: An Assessment of Where OECD Countries Stand (https://www.oecd.org/sdd/measuring-distance-to-the-sdg-targets-2019-a8caf3fa-en.htm).
